PPP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2015 in Review
83 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Primero Mining Corp (PPP) for Q1 2015, worth a combined $380M — up 2.2% from $372M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 11 funds closed out of PPP and 9 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 35 trimmed existing stakes and 28 added.
The largest buyer was Bank of Montreal, adding an estimated $15.6M. The largest seller was Tocqueville Asset Management, cutting an estimated $11.9M.
